Chef Lisa Marie White is someone who dares to change. During a pilgrimage in her late 30s on the Camino de Santiago in Europe, she remembered her love of baking and decided to pursue it with a professional passion and scholar's heart. She's baked all over the country, from Domenica and Willa Jean in New Orleans to The Thompson Hotel in Nashville, and she's now brought her unique style and talent to Biscuit Love in Nashville, a sensational spot you've heard about before way back on Episode 19. Lisa Marie prefers to be behind the scenes, but I persuaded her to the mic because her knowledge -- and that pastry passion -- is always a sugar high.
